MariaDB 10.9 zaten yayınlandı ve bunlar onun haberleri

Lansmanı yeni DBMS şubesinin ilk kararlı sürümü MariaDB10.9 (10.9.2), geriye dönük uyumluluğu koruyan ve ek depolama motorlarının ve gelişmiş özelliklerin entegrasyonu ile ayırt edilen bir MySQL dalı geliştirilmektedir.

MariaDB'nin gelişimi, bireysel satıcılardan bağımsız, tamamen açık ve şeffaf bir geliştirme sürecinin ardından bağımsız MariaDB Vakfı tarafından denetlenir.

MariaDB, birçok Linux dağıtımında (RHEL, SUSE, Fedora, openSUSE, Slackware, OpenMandriva, ROSA, Arch Linux, Debian) MySQL yerine gönderilir ve büyük projeler tarafından benimsenmiştir.

MariaDB 10.9'ün başlıca yeni özellikleri

MariaDB'nin bu yeni sürümünde şu vurgulanmaktadır: verilerdeki kesişmeleri algılamak için JSON_OVERLAPS işlevi eklendi iki JSON belgesinden (örneğin, her iki belge de ortak bir anahtar/değer çiftine veya ortak dizi öğelerine sahip nesneler içeriyorsa true döndürür).

Ayrıca, aşağıdaki güvenlik açıkları için ilgili düzeltmelerin yapıldığı vurgulanmıştır: CVE-2022-32082, CVE-2022-32089, CVE-2022-32081, CVE-2018-25032, CVE-2022-32091 y CVE-2022-32084

Öne çıkan bir diğer değişiklik ise ifadelerin JSONPath, aralıkları belirleme yeteneği sağlar (örneğin, 1'den 4'e kadar dizi öğelerini kullanmak için "$[1 ila 4]" ve kuyruktaki ilk öğeyi görüntülemek için negatif dizinler).

Buna ek olarak, Hashicorp Vault KMS'de depolanan anahtarları kullanarak tablolardaki verileri şifrelemek için Hashicorp Key Management eklentisinin eklendiğini görebiliriz.

Fayda için iken mysqlbinlog, artık yeni seçenekleriniz var gtid_domain_id'ye göre filtrelemek için "–do-domain-ids", "–ignore-domain-ids" ve "–ignore-server-ids".

Harici izleme sistemleri tarafından kullanılabilen ayrı bir JSON dosyasında wsrep durum değişkenlerini yansıtma özelliği eklendi.

Optimizer, 10.3'e yükselttikten sonra tüm bölümleri kullanır, çok tablolu GÜNCELLEME veya DELETE sorguları için, optimize edici, güncellenmekte veya silinmekte olan tablo için bölüm budama optimizasyonunu uygulayamadı.

Bunun yanı sıra, IN tuşu için bir aralık optimize edici regresyonu gerçekleştirdi (const, ....), MariaDB 10.5.9 ve sonraki sürümlerinde MDEV-9750 için düzeltmeye sahip bir sorun zaten vardı. Bu çözüm, Optimizer_max_sel_arg_weight'ı tanıttı. Optimizer_max_sel_arg_weight çok yüksek bir değere veya sıfıra ("sınırsız" anlamına gelir) ayarlanırsa ve yoğun grafikler oluşturan sorgular çalıştırılırsa, performansın yavaş olduğunu fark edebilirler.

Diğer düzeltmeler MariaDB'nin bu yeni sürümünde yapılanlar, InnoDB bozulmasında dosya kilitleme eksikliği nedeniyle, hem de ALTER TABLE IMPORT TABLESPACE'de bir düzeltme şifrelenmiş bir tabloyu bozan, ayrıca ALTER TABLE yanlış çıktısını düzeltti, kilitlenme kurtarma düzeltmeleri, DD hata kurtarma düzeltmeleri, bozuk verilerde kilitlenmeleri önledi, sabit toplu yükleme hata düzeltmeleri ve hata düzeltmeleri performansı.

Diğer değişikliklerden bu yeni sürümden öne çıkan:

  • JSON çıktısı için "PARSEL GÖSTER [FORMAT=JSON]" modu desteği eklendi.
  • "SHOW EXPLAIN" ifadesi artık "EXPLAIN FOR CONNECTION" sözdizimini desteklemektedir.
  • innodb_change_buffering ve eski değişkenleri kullanımdan kaldırıldı (değişkeni old_mode ile değiştirildi).
  • Kesme işareti ve zorunlu kelimelerle TAM METİN arama
  • Optimizer, 10.3'e yükselttikten sonra tüm bölümleri kullanır
  • Çok tablolu GÜNCELLEME veya DELETE sorguları için, optimize edici, güncellenmekte veya silinmekte olan tablo için bölüm budama optimizasyonunu uygulayamadı.
  • Yeni mariadb istemci seçeneği, -enable-cleartext-plugin. Seçenek hiçbir şey yapmaz ve yalnızca MySQL uyumluluğu amaçlıdır.
  • JSON_EXTRACT üzerinde kilitle
    ALTER TABLE ALGORITHM=NOCOPY yükseltmeden sonra çalışmıyor
  • Sunucu, AÇIK durumda bilinmeyen sütunla GÖRÜNÜM OLUŞTURMA başarısız
  • password_reuse_check eklentisi, kullanıcı adı ve şifreyi birleştirir
  • MariaDB Kullanımdan Kaldırma Politikası uyarınca, bu, ppc10.9el için Debian 10 "Buster" için MariaDB 64'un son sürümü olacaktır.

Son olarak, bu yeni sürüm hakkında daha fazla bilgi edinmek istiyorsanız, ayrıntıları şu adresten kontrol edebilirsiniz: aşağıdaki bağlantı.


Yorumunuzu bırakın

E-posta hesabınız yayınlanmayacak. Gerekli alanlar ile işaretlenmiştir *

*

*

  1. Verilerden sorumlu: Miguel Ángel Gatón
  2. Verilerin amacı: Kontrol SPAM, yorum yönetimi.
  3. Meşruiyet: Onayınız
  4. Verilerin iletilmesi: Veriler, yasal zorunluluk dışında üçüncü kişilere iletilmeyecektir.
  5. Veri depolama: Occentus Networks (AB) tarafından barındırılan veritabanı
  6. Haklar: Bilgilerinizi istediğiniz zaman sınırlayabilir, kurtarabilir ve silebilirsiniz.